Understanding Water Damage Restoration

Water damage restoration is more than just drying out a wet floor or fixing a leaky pipe. It’s a complex process that needs expertise, specialized equipment, and a deep understanding of the underlying causes of water damage. In the 74077 area, water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, sump pump failure, and frozen pipes. Structural Drying Process

After water has been extracted, our team will begin the structural drying process. This involves using spec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including walls, ceilings, and floors. We’ll also monitor the moisture levels to ensure that the area is completely dry. This process can take several days to a week, depending on the severity of the damage. Moisture Detection and Monitoring

During the restoration process, our team will use specialized equipment to detect and monitor moisture levels in the affected area. This ensures that we identify any hidden pockets of water that may have gone undetected. We’ll also use thermal imaging cameras to detect areas of high moisture. This allows us to address any potential issues before they become major problems.

Restoration vs. DIY

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es This is a serious situation that needs professional attention to prevent secondary damage and ensure your safety.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es It’s not safe to handle wet drywall, and our team has the expertise and equipment to handle this situation.
Leaky pipe under sink Yes No You can likely handle a leaky pipe on your own, but be sure to turn off the water supply and contain the leak to pr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es This is a serious situation that needs professional attention to prevent secondary damage and ensure your safety.
Small water spill on hardwood floor Yes No You can likely hand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 74077 Area

The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 74077 area.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ved and work with you to ensure that you receive the maximum coverage for your water damage restoration need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The cost of emergency water extraction dep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Structural Drying Process $2,000 – $5,000 The cost of structural drying depends on the size of the affected area and the number of days required to complete the process.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$500 – $1,500 The cost of moisture detection and monitoring depends on the size of the affected area and the number of tests required.
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$3,000 The cost of sewage cleanup dep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Basement Flood Recovery $3,000 – $6,000 The cost of basement flood recovery dep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

How do I know if I have hidden water damage behind walls?

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ect, but there are several signs to look out for, including warping or buckling walls, peeling paint, and water stains. If you suspect that you have hidden water damage, it’s best to call a professional to assess the situation.
